Integral damp proofing in concrete involves adding materials to the concrete mix to make the concrete itself impermeable. ![]() A common example is polyethylene sheeting laid under a concrete slab to prevent the concrete from gaining moisture through capillary action. A damp-proof membrane (DPM) is a membrane material applied to prevent moisture transmission.A DPC layer is usually laid below all masonry walls, regardless if the wall is a load bearing wall or a partition wall. The damp proof course may be horizontal or vertical. ![]() Rising damp is the effect of water rising from the ground into property.
